Tripadvisor, Inc. (NASDAQ:TRIP - Get Free Report) was the recipient of a large decrease in short interest in the month of January. As of January 31st, there was short interest totalling 8,030,000 shares, a decrease of 23.5% from the January 15th total of 10,500,000 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 2,480,000 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 3.2 days. Currently, 7.5% of the shares of the company are short sold.

Tripadvisor Company Profile

TripAdvisor, Inc operates as an online travel company, primarily engages in the provision of travel guidance products and services worldwide. The company operates in three segments: Brand Tripadvisor, Viator, and TheFork. The Brand Tripadvisor segment offers travel guidance platforms for travelers to discover, generate, and share authentic user-generated content in the form of ratings and reviews for destinations, points-of-interest, experiences, accommodations, restaurants, and cruises.
